Iron Dome can't intercept ballistic missiles.

Iron Dome was designed to intercept Grad rockets and mortar shells with predictable trajectories.

Iron Dome can't even intercept cruise missiles, let alone ballistic missiles.

Jewsrael has David's Sling and Arrow for ballistic missiles.

IO is not a long term solution, missile has to slow so AI can run optics. It’s nothing new we saw this a decade ago on PG Missiles, the optics have improved but the physics remain the same, a missile with a plasma shroud cannot see, go too fast you cannot see.

It might make more sense to use a high powered laser in the cone to basically “laser designate” the target as it comes down. Same power laser modern laser guns use except without the destructive capacity (obviously).
 
that used Zolafaqar and maybe Dezful (1000km) not MRBMs

It is not the range of the missile that makes a difference, it is the re entry speed and shape of the RV.

A 10,000KM could also have a optic warhead if needed.

the range of the missile is very important , the error in guidance system is by degree not speed , the more the range , error will be larger
 
the range of the missile is very important , the error in guidance system is by degree not speed , the more the range , error will be larger

The longer range missiles can offset this with more powerful gyroscopes (FOG) to keep error rate lower and use I/O in terminal phase.

Like I said there is no roadblock preventing an MRBM or ICBM to use I/O if the guidance system is adequate. It’s the speed that has to be slowed so I/O can actually “see” or provide any degree of assistance in course correction.

But is slowing a Mach 6-8 warhead down to Mach 1-2 worth it in order to get improved guidance at the cost of higher interception rate?
